Performance Characteristics

Use cases for this acoustic solution are primarily focused on interior sound absorption rather than full sound isolation. These acoustic foam panels contribute to internal room clarity by limiting echo and reverberation patterns. Such characteristics may prove useful in personal audio recording scenarios, podcast setups, or voiceover environments where clarity of captured sound is prioritized over containment of external noise.

The foam exhibits a moderate density and compressibility profile that allows it to recover its shape after handling. This behavior may support long-term use and installation stability, provided that the panels are applied correctly and not repeatedly repositioned. In conditions where low-frequency control is a critical requirement, supplementary treatment with thicker or multi-layered materials may be necessary.
